Film & Flourish is a wedding filmmaking service based in Virginia, USA, near Charlottesville, led by Andrew Gilford. Rather than simply documenting the wedding day, it focuses on “sound, movement, emotion,” and storytelling, helping couples relive how their wedding day felt. The website also mentions that it offers educational services for wedding industry professionals.
Based on the site content, its services cover three types of scenarios: Weddings, Elopements, and Adventures, corresponding to traditional weddings, intimate elopements, and meaningful moments such as engagements, anniversaries, or everyday life milestones. The brand emphasizes understanding couples before filming, listening to their vision, and serving clients with a friend-like relationship. Featured films include weddings in Charlottesville, Corolla, Washington D.C., and other locations, suggesting experience with destination shoots. The education section includes long-term mentorship, 1:1 video calls, and a Facebook community, aimed at helping wedding videographers improve their creativity, service, and client acquisition.
The website does not disclose specific packages, starting prices, payment methods, delivery timelines, or the number of finished films. A client testimonial mentions that the service would be “worth five times the price,” but this only reflects perceived value and should not be treated as an actual pricing reference. Regarding copyright, the footer includes Terms & Privacy Policy, but the captured Terms & Conditions page still contains placeholder text and does not clarify film ownership, commercial usage rights, music licensing, or editing/modification rights.
The strengths are clear brand storytelling, a focused creative direction, and client reviews that repeatedly mention professionalism, warmth, punctuality, and the ability to capture emotion and details. The service also appears strong at reassuring and guiding couples who are not used to being on camera. The downside is limited transparency around key information: pricing, contract terms, copyright, delivery formats, availability, and travel fees are not clearly stated in the main content and would require further inquiry.
It is suitable for couples getting married on the U.S. East Coast, especially in Virginia, Washington D.C., North Carolina, and surrounding areas, who value cinematic, emotion-driven wedding films.
